Sample simulated data for Emax exposure-response models with covariates.

Usage

emax_df

Format

A data frame with columns:

dose

Nominal dose, units not specified

exposure_1

Exposure value, units and metric not specified

exposure_2

Exposure value, units and metric not specified, but different from exposure_1

response_1

Continuous response value (units not specified)

response_2

Binary response value (group labels not specified)

cnt_a

Continuous valued covariate

cnt_b

Continuous valued covariate

cnt_c

Continuous valued covariate

bin_d

Binary valued covariate

bin_e

Binary valued covariate

Details

This simulated dataset is entirely synthetic. It is a generic data set that can be used to illustrate Emax modeling. It contains variables corresponding to dose and exposure, and includes both a continuous response variable and a binary response variable. Three continuous valued covariates are included, along with two binary covariates.

You can find the data generating code in the package source code, under R/data.R
